Lots of great movies featuring Asian actors came out this summer from The Hangover to Star Trek. Check out my list of the top 5 movies of the summer.

1. The Hangover. This movie was beyond funny. In fact, my dean was talking to me about it, how he missed half the movie because he kept laughing. I am telling you to go watch this movie right now! Dr. Ken was so funny. He was like the Asian gangster in this movie.

2. G.I. Joe. I was wondering if it was going to be some children’s movie because G.I. Joe is an action figure. However, with Lee Byung Hun and a good story line, it was pretty nice. There were lots of funny scenes as well.

3. Haeundae. This movie is a Korean disaster movie. It was one of the 5 movies in Korea that was able to reach 10,000,000 viewers. Unfortunately, the movie was copied and uploaded online.

4. Star Trek. I’m guilty of not watching John Cho play Sulu in this Star Trek movie, but it did great this summer in the box office. It’s on my list of movies I need to watch.

5. White on Rice. Finally, a comedy about Asian Americans, featuring an all Asian cast. This just came out and I’m dying to see this.
